I know you mean well but referencing Atlanta and SoWal makes me sad. South Walton is losing what makes it special. It may be hard for some to see, especially when you drive in from the city. But what is happening here happens to every wonderful piece of the world sooner or later. It's discovered and then gets ruined. The ruin creeps in.

As for your suggestion about accesses....... the bed tax dollars paid to TDC go toward maintaining accesses and for the most part they do a good job. Some say the TDC isn't needed. I think more dollars need to go to protecting what we have which will always bring visitors.

We're on the map people! Let's stop spending on advertising and spend more protecting and maintaining and enhancing.

This is not easy. It's a mindset change. We have to educate rental owners and bed tax collectors that taking care of South Walton brings as many visitors as ads. A better place allows for higher rents. We need to be raising our image and increasing loyalty.
